Archer is an aerospace company based in San Jose, California building an all-electric vertical takeoff and landing aircraft with a mission to advance the benefits of sustainable air mobility. We are designing, manufacturing, and operating an all-electric aircraft that can carry four passengers while producing minimal noise.

About The Role:

At Archer, we are scaling production of our cutting-edge eVTOL Aircraft. As a member of the Manufacturing Design Engineering (MDE) team, you will help bridge aircraft design and production.

In this role, you will unify methods and standards across the organization, consolidating complex processes into a central, version-controlled knowledge base. Working cross-functionally with Design, Quality, Supply Chain, and Certification teams, you will define and scale the manufacturing solutions required to bring the future of flight to market.

What You’ll Do:

  • Develop, document, and maintain standardized manufacturing engineering methods and best practices across the Manufacturing Design Engineering (MDE) organization
  • Define common frameworks for manufacturing planning, process definition, work instruction structure, and build readiness across development, certification, and production phases
  • Lead the definition of facility planning standards, including space allocation, line layouts, material flow, aisleways, egress, and infrastructure requirements
  • Define and standardize tooling and ground support equipment (GSE) requirements, including classification, readiness criteria, and integration into manufacturing plans
  • Develop standardized approaches for test and functional test equipment, ensuring alignment with build sequencing, quality, and certification requirements
  • Partner closely with MDE functional teams, Industrialization, Quality, Facilities, and Operations to ensure standards are practical, scalable, and aligned with execution realities
  • Support governance of standards adoption, identify gaps through build feedback, and drive continuous improvement based on data and lessons learned
  • Act as a technical resource and mentor for MDE engineers, enabling consistent execution across programs and teams

What You Need:

  • Bachelor’s or advanced degree in Mechanical, Aerospace, Manufacturing Engineering, or related field
  • 10+ years of experience in aerospace manufacturing engineering or a similarly complex, regulated environment
  • Deep hands-on experience with manufacturing planning, process definition, work instructions, tooling, and production support
  • Proven ability to define and implement standardized engineering methods across multiple teams or programs
  • Strong systems thinking and documentation skills, with the ability to translate complex operations into clear, repeatable standards
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ills, with experience influencing without direct authority
  • Familiarity with FAA certification considerations and their impact on manufacturing processes

Bonus Qualifications:

  • NX Experience
  • Teamcenter Experience
  • SAP Experience
  • Experience building manufacturing standards in a scaling organization
  • eVTOL or Advanced Air Mobility Experience
